THE RAMEN TRIO OF ORLANDO

Ramen, ramen, ramen... one of my favorite Asian dishes consisting of Chinese-style wheat noodles served in either a meat, fish, or vegetable broth seasoned with soy sauce or miso and topped off with a protein, nori, menma, and scallions. Orlando is a very diverse city that has hundreds of restaurants ranging from American food to Indian food. In this blog post, I'm going to be talking about my favorite top three places to go when I'm craving ramen, these places are perfect for both meat-eaters and plant-based.

  1. Jinya Ramen Bar

Jinya is the perfect place for a date night or just a place to hang out with friends. They have a bar and serve from rice bowls to ramen which is one of the best, in my opinion. Jinya has two vegan options which are the flying vegan harvest and spicy creamy vegan ramen.


2. DOMU

DOMU is a local restaurant in Orlando are serving house-made noodles, creative takes on small plates, and seasonal cocktails. They have a vegan ramen bowl with a choice of shio or spicy miso flavor.


3. Milk Tea Cafe

Milk tea cafe is in the Kissimmee area offering a variety of different milk teas with boba and they also offer some good decent ramen. They have miso-based ramen and Kawawa which is kimchi based and although they have meat in them, they will accommodate you if you ask for it vegetarian style.
